Output 290240e42291309b4bc1b49c868501b5adbca092de76e821754498822ebb983b:17

value
3188646
script pubkey
OP_0 OP_PUSHBYTES_20 65a34f2c75ed33d0369e10b5a17e059ca18fcb15
address
bc1qvk357tr4a5eaqd57zz66zls9njscljc4dd8s9d
transaction
290240e42291309b4bc1b49c868501b5adbca092de76e821754498822ebb983b
confirmations
121901
spent
true